WebDocumentation: Written records regarding the petty cash transaction, including, but not limited to: 1) a completed petty cash voucher slip (with signatures); 2) details regarding compensation for Human Subjects; 3) a detailed cash register receipt or invoice; 4) documentation of the fund number; and 5) PI approval (if applicable).
